I perceive my advanced tools akin to a broom.
I can mop floors alright, but I also don’t want to sit down with a cloth to do it.
If I can’t do that myself, and it does that instead of me, that’s not just my tool, that’s my employee, and the one I now depend on.
‘AI’ companies sell us billions of hours of other people’s labor to replace our own need to interject our experience and ingrain themselves into our routine. Like the coming of ads, it’s already normalized. But this time, critical parts of our life has this black box dependancy and subscription.

Also, LLM doesn’t usually have memory or experience. It’s the first page of Google search every time you put in your tokens. A forever trainee that would never leave that stage in their career.
Human’s abilities like pattern recognition, intuition, acummulation of proven knowledge in combination makes us become more and more effective at finding the right solution to anything.
The LLM bubble can’t replace it and also actively hurts it as people get distanced from actual knowledge by the code door of LLM. They learn how to formulate their requests instead of learning how to do stuff they actually need. This outsourcing makes sense when you need a cookie recipe once a year, it doesn’t when you work in a bakery. What makes the doug behave each way? You don’t need to ask so you wouldn’t know.
And the difference between asking like Lemmy and asking a chatbot is the ultimative convincing manner in which it tells you things, while forums, Q&A boards, blogs handled by people usually have some of these humane qualities behind replies and also an option for someone else to throw a bag of dicks at the suggestion of formating your system partition or turning stuff off and on.
